Our verdict is Benign. Variant got -11 ACMG points: 2P and 13B. PM2BP4_StrongBP6_Very_StrongBP7
The NM_144991.3(TSPEAR):c.1524C>T(p.Tyr508Tyr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000341 in 1,614,082 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Tyr508Tyr in exon 9 of TSPEAR: This variant is not expected to have clinical sig nificance because it does not alter an amino acid residue and is not located wit hin the splice consensus sequence. It has been identified in 0.1% (4/4406) of Af rican American chromosomes from a broad population by the NHLBI Exome Sequencing Project (http://evs.gs.washington.edu/EVS; dbSNP rs140557785). -
